Do you plan to start a business and now wondering what sector to invest in? Online gambling can be another good business venture to think about. The online gambling industry is of interest due to its growth and digital reach. Sports fans are increasingly going online. Mobile access and real time engagement has changed the way betting platforms work. For entrepreneurs, the opportunity seems bright especially in cricket-focused markets.

However, getting into this industry is by no means simple. Behind the surface, there are a variety of serious challenges. From regulation to technology and trust, there are areas that require careful planning. Understanding these challenges from the outset helps entrepreneurs avoid costly mistakes and unrealistic expectations.

  • Uncertainty in Law and Regulations

One of the greatest challenges is the legal environment. Gambling laws in India are complicated and scattered. Regulations vary from state to state. What is allowed in one part of the world may be restricted in another.

This uncertainty makes new businesses riskier. Licensing requirements are not always clear cut. Entrepreneurs have to spend time on legal research and professional advice. Failure to comply with can result in fines or shutdowns. Regulation is not a one-time job. Continuous monitoring is necessary because laws change.

Compliance also has an impact on partnerships. Payment providers and advertisers don’t want to use unregulated platforms. Without legal clarity, it is difficult and risky to scale the business.

  • High Technology and Infrastructure Costs

Technology is the backbone of any online gambling platform. Users have high expectations for speed, accuracy and reliability. Building or licensing such systems requires a lot of up-front investment.

Servers will have to handle high traffic during the live matches. Lack of being operational at critical times kills credibility on the spot. Security systems are also important. Platforms are dealing with sensitive financial and personal information. A single breach may permanently destroy trust.

Live betting features complicate the issue. Real time updates, real time transactions, and dynamic pricing require advanced infrastructure. Managing accurate India cricket betting odds in real time requires powerful data integration and constant system monitoring.

  • Risk Management and Accuracy of Pricing

Setting the odds is not guesswork. It is a science that is based on probability, data, and user behavior. Poor risk management can result in significant financial losses in a relatively short period of time.

Cricket betting is a particularly dynamic one. Match momentum is rapidly changing. Injuries, weather and player performance all have an impact. Platforms need to adjust prices in real time in order to stay balanced.

Managing exposure is another problem. Bets that are large or unusual need to be monitored. Without the right controls in place, an unexpected liability may arise for a platform. Maintaining fair and competitive India cricket betting odds while maintaining margins is one of the most difficult tasks for new operators.

  • Trust and User Credibility Issues

Trust is difficult to gain and easy to lose. New platforms have a hard time persuading users of their reliability. Many users are wary because of fraud and scams in the industry.

Delayed payments, unclear rules, or poor communication destroy reputation in a short period of time. Even small problems spread quickly on social media. Negative perception can preempt growth before it begins.

Building trust involves being transparent, consistent and having reliable customer support. This requires time and investment. New businesses tend to underestimate the time required to establish a credible brand in gambling markets.

  • Payment Processing and Barriers to Financing

Handling payments is another big challenge. Users are accustomed to fast deposits and withdrawals. Any delay leads to frustration and suspicion.

Payment providers may be reluctant to collaborate with gambling platforms because of the regulatory risks. This leads to limitations and higher costs. Managing multiple payment methods adds complexity of operations.

Currency management, transaction fees and fraud prevention also have an impact on profitability. A platform must strike a balance between being convenient for users and having strict financial controls to be sustainable.

  • Marketing in a Highly Competitive Space

The gambling market is congested. Many platforms are competing in the same user base. Marketing costs are high, especially in digital channels.

Advertising restrictions make promotion even more difficult. Some platforms are heavily dependent on bonuses to attract users. This approach decreases margins and attracts short term activity rather than loyalty.

Standing out takes a strong brand and value proposition. Without differentiation, customer acquisition becomes costly and unsustainable.

  • Responsible Gaming & Ethical Pressure

Responsible gaming is no longer an option. Regulators and users expect the platforms to safeguard the players from harm. Implementing limits, self-exclusion tools and monitoring systems requires more resources.

Ignoring this responsibility brings more legal and reputational risk. Ethical failures can draw the attention of regulators and the public. Long term success is a matter of balancing profitability with user well-being.

Conclusion

Starting an online gambling business is a lot more difficult than most people think. Legal uncertainty, the cost of technology, pricing accuracy and building trust all require serious commitment. Managing payments, marketing competition, ethical responsibility is further adding to the complexity.

Entrepreneurs who venture into this space without preparation are at high risk. Those who are aware of the difficulties ahead can plan strategically and invest wisely. With patience, compliance and good systems it is possible to build a sustainable platform, but not if these challenges are underestimated instead of tackled head on.
